Educating technophile artists and artophile technologists: A successful experiment in higher education |
Abstract | ||
---|---|---|
Over the past few decades, the arts have become increasingly dependent on and influenced by the development of computer technology. In the 1960s pioneering artists experimented with the emergent computer technology and more recently the majority of artists have come to use this technology to develop and even to implement their artefacts. |
